ok so. the next main
thing is picking the perfect
font for your cover.
firstly , don't use a lot
of fonts on your cover.
it makes it look too extra ,
unprofessional and over -
whelming. ive seen ppl
use a different font for the
title , subtitle , author name
etc etc and the cover looks
like a mess. sometimes , you
can pull it off , but not usually.

furthermore , try to align
everything written on the
cover like this :
aligning all your fonts
makes it look uniform
and professional.
furthermore , try not to
use cursive fonts a lot.
i usually prefer to use
minimalist cursive fonts
like this one bc it looks aesthetic :
always pair a cursive font
with a sans script font , bc
pairing two cursive fonts
together makes it look tacky.
you're making a book cover ,
not a wedding card.
